Output 312e5a280179a20ab1eb9141770a3ef01aa11630b421039783606f011fc2101a:1

value
136758526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61ee45dbd21df27cd99625a01a2cde2dc6c3363c OP_EQUAL
address
3AcpueAfxD2xA5vbsG4SvnFipS84i9jaMz
transaction
312e5a280179a20ab1eb9141770a3ef01aa11630b421039783606f011fc2101a
confirmations
321433
spent
true